The panelists debate the costs of multiple myeloma treatment. There are costs for initial treatment, maintenance care, and the price that comes with taking multiple drugs. It’s important that treatment is the “best at the beginning.”
In general, the disease is extremely expensive to treat, and there may be nearly 100,000 patients who suffer from the disease. Treatment can last for years, which only adds to costs.
Risk factors are also analyzed by the panel. Dr Kumar notes that some studies have shown African Americans and people who are obese may be at increased risk for developing the disease.
